Understanding the Mesothelioma Lawsuit Trial ProcessMesothelioma, an unusual however aggressive cancer mostly triggered by asbestos exposure, frequently necessitates legal action for victims looking for justice and compensation. The trial process for Mesothelioma Lawsuit Claims claims can be complex and lengthy, requiring extensive preparation and understanding. Summary of Mesothelioma LawsuitsMesothelioma Lawsuit Eligibility claims are usually submitted versus companies accountable for the asbestos exposure that resulted in the disease. Victims can pursue different types of claims, consisting of injury and wrongful death suits. Secret Steps in the Trial ProcessThe mesothelioma trial process is intricate and can be broken down into several key steps:Step 1: Consultation with an AttorneyValue: Initial assessments help victims understand their rights and the practicality of their claims.Action: Choose an attorney who focuses on asbestos-related cases for specialist assistance.Step 2: Filing the LawsuitDetails: The lawyer prepares and submits a grievance outlining the plaintiff's claims and the defendants.Where: Lawsuits are usually submitted in jurisdictions where the accused's business is situated or where the plaintiff was exposed to asbestos.Step 3: Discovery PhaseWhat Happens: Both sides gather proof through depositions, interrogatories, and document requests.Result: This phase can take lots of months and is vital for developing a strong case.Step 4: Pre-Trial MotionsPurpose: Either celebration can submit movements to dismiss the case or exclude specific proof.Outcome: The court rules on these movements, which can substantially impact how the case earnings.Step 5: TrialJury Selection: A jury is picked unless the case is chosen by a judge.Providing the Case: Both celebrations present their proof and witness testament.Deliberation: The jury deliberates and reaches a decision.Step 6: VerdictOutcomes: If the jury guidelines in favor of the plaintiff, a financial award is determined. Often Asked QuestionsQ1: What is the average compensation for mesothelioma cases?A: Compensation can vary greatly depending upon the specifics of the case, however settlements can vary from numerous thousands to millions of dollars.Q2: How long do I need to submit a mesothelioma lawsuit?A: Statutes of limitations vary by state but usually variety from 1 to 3 years from the date of medical diagnosis or discovery of the illness.Q3: Can I file a lawsuit if the company responsible is no longer in organization?A: Yes, lots of business have established trust funds to compensate victims even after stating bankruptcy.Q4: Will my case go to trial?A: Not necessarily; lots of mesothelioma claims are settled out of court before reaching trial.Q5: Do I require to go to court?A: Participation in court might be required, but numerous cases reach settlement before a trial is required.5.
